Out of the Blue | Emberly Barbary | Brought to You by Schrader’s

Name: Emberly Barbary
Date of Birth: June 6, 2019
Hometown: Lanark, Ontario
Grade: Entering Grade 1
Race Number: 926
Bike: KTM e3
Race Club: AMO and BTB
Classes: Girls 4-8, raced electric 4-7 & PW mod 4-8 at ECAN

Who/what inspired you to get onto a dirtbike and how long have you been racing/riding?
I started on an e2 when I was 4 years old in the Tykes class at AMO! I was always at the track because my dad and brother raced so I wanted to try too!
When not on a dirt bike how do you keep yourself busy? Are you involved in any other sports or extracurricular activities?
In the winter I do gymnastics and acro dance, and in the spring I play ball hockey! When at the track I can be found doing cartwheels and playing in whatever sand I can find when it’s not my time to hit the gate!

Who is your all-time favourite rider and why?
Ryan Mott, because he has been working really hard and now he’s racing 250 Pro.
What was your first race number and how did you choose it?
I first picked 629 because my brother was 629. My birthday is the 6th, my brother is the 9th and there is 2 of us, my dad’s birthday is the 29th – it also was our first home address. Once we started falling into the same classes I had to change so now my number is his backwards.

What is your favourite track and why?
Sand Del Lee. We live 20 minutes from there so I get to ride it often. I also have a track in my backyard and it’s my second favourite!
What event do you look forward to most every year? What’s one you don’t ever want to miss?
All of them! Getting to hang out with my friends all the time and race my dirt bike is always something I never want to miss out on!

From your first ride to where you are now what is something you never thought you would be able to overcome but have?
I used to let the gate drop and then wait for everyone to go, now I let the gate drop and pin it!
Who would you like to thank?
My mom & dad for supporting me, my brother for giving me all the tips, Ryan Mott for helping my dad teach me to ride & 223 Motorsports.
